DiViT. No, C-Cube does not need this market. But it points out a problem. Like you mentioned, C-Cube currently derives a good portion of it's revenue from a commodity business, decoders. When you're out trying to sell your company, it may be difficult to justify a real premium because of this. It's not worth $2 billion.

BTW, I sold my entire CUBE position at $28 after holding it for three years. I just broke down and almost broke even. It was a substantial position.

If you're looking for price appreciation, Oracle looks much more attractive at $25 than C-Cube. Hopefully Alex will do the right thing though.
